NASA is a government organization independent from the executive departments but with a narrower focus on space science and mann
soldi70 [24.7K]

Answer:

NASA is a government organization independent from the executive departments but with a narrower focus on space science and manned spaceflight policy. NASA is a(n) <u>Independent executive agency.</u>

Explanation:

NASA is the space agency of the federal government. That is to say, that it is part of the executive branch.  It is an independent agency because it is not under the direct control of the president. The organization and goals of NASA or any independent executive agency are in statutes that the Congress has to approve.

Jaylin, who teaches ninth-grade science, praises his students' test-taking efforts rather than their test-taking abilities. this
Lady_Fox [76]

I believe the answer is: their growth mind-set.

The growth mind-set refers to the belief that all skills/abilities can be developed as long as people are willing to put in their effort and dedication.

Insulting the students when they have a bad test results could damage their confidence and discourage them to try to put more effort in the future. Praising their effort on the other hand would make the students feel good about it and make them more likely to put more effort in the future.
